Swansea City Under-23s’ Premier League Cup hopes suffered a blow as they were beaten 4-2 by Charlton Athletic at Landore.

Chuks Aneke scored a hat-trick as the Addicks took the spoils in the Group A clash – inflicting a third defeat from four games in the competition for the Swans.

Kenneth Yao was also on target for the visitors, while Liam Cullen’s brace proved no more than a consolation for Jon Grey’s side, who saw their four-match unbeaten run come to an end.

Cullen was one of only four players to remain from Monday’s 5-1 victory over Middlesbrough, along with Brandon Cooper, Oli Cooper and skipper Jack Evans.

There were recalls to the starting 11 for Ryan Bevan, Jake Thomas, Simon Paulet, Keiran Evans and Mason Jones-Thomas, while Jacob Jones returned from injury for his first appearance since the end of September.

The Swans, whose squad boasted an average age of just under 19, fell behind after just two minutes at Landore, with Aneke opening the scoring.

The hosts responded well and equalised in the 14th minute as, fresh from his hat-trick against Middlesbrough, Cullen brought the contest level.

However, Charlton regained their initiative through Yao in the 28th minute and went into overdrive before half-time, with Aneke scoring twice in the space of five minutes to complete his treble and give the visitors a commanding 4-1 lead at the break.

The Swans improved in the second half; enjoying good spells of possession as they looked to find a way back into the contest.

They pulled a goal back through Cullen’s 13th of the season and sixth in three games, but were unable to avoid a third consecutive defeat in Group A.

Although, a huge positive for the Swans came in the 67th minute when, 16 months since his last competitive appearance, defender Ben Erickson made an emotional return as a substitute following a long battle with injuries.

The young Swans are back in action on January 27, when they travel to Everton for their crucial Premier League International Cup showdown.
